> > I need to use some my C function in a Qt project.
> > But when I try to include and build them, the compiler
> > answers:
> >
> > gcc -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-I. -I. -I.. -I/usr/lib/qt/include
> > -I/usr/X11R6/include     -O0 -g3 -Wall    -c plates.c
> > /bin/sh ../libtool --mode=link g++  -O0 -g3 -Wall      -o plates4linux
> > -L/usr/X11R6/lib   plates.o neural.o imageproc.o debug.o
> > plates4linuxview.o plates4linux.o main.o plates4linuxview.moc.o
> > plates4linux.moc.o  -lqt -lXext -lX11
> > g++ -O0 -g3 -Wall -o plates4linux plates.o neural.o imageproc.o debug.o
> > plates4linuxview.o plates4linux.o main.o plates4linuxview.moc.o
> > plates4linux.moc.o  -L/usr/X11R6/lib -lqt -lXext -lX11
> > plates4linux.o: In function `Plates4Linux::_RunPlatesRecognition(void)':
> > /home/fabrizio/projects/plates4linux/plates4linux/plates4linux.cpp:340:
> > undefined reference to `B(void)'
> > /home/fabrizio/projects/plates4linux/plates4linux/plates4linux.cpp:340:
> > undefined reference to `B(void)'
> > coll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
> > make: *** [plates4linux] Error 1
> > *** failed ***
> >
> > where B is the C function declared in a <file>.c with <header>.h as
> >
> > int B(void);
> >
> > Can you help me?
> 
> Hi,
> 
> did you declared the follow in your header?
> -----
> 
> #ifdef __cplusplus
> extern "C" {
> #endif
> 
> int B(void);
> 
> #ifdef __cplusplus
> }
> #endif

Thank you everyone.
it works with extern "C"
